BIBLE. The Holy Bible, Containing The Old and New Testaments: Translated out of the Original Tongues: and with the Former Translations Diligently Compared and Revised by His Majesty's Special Command. Appointed to be Read in Churches. [1], 1149, [1], 343 pp. Thick 12mo., 140 x 85 mm, bound in deluxe blind stamped contemporary oxblood morocco, spine gilt, ruled in gilt, a.e.g. London: George Eyre and Andrew Strahan, 1826.
Stereotype Edition. A lovely nineteenth-century English Bible in a handsome Cathedral Binding. These bindings, which were quite popular at the time of this Bible's publication, featured leather tooled in a gothic architectural motif. Contemporary ownership inscription on the second blank "Sophia Godfrey Barenstone. June 21st 1829." Aside from a small stain on the cover, this is a fine example.
